Si PIN photodiodes S14536/S14537 series-1

Si detectors for high-energy particles The S14536/S14537 series are large-area photodiodes specifically designed for the direct detection of high-energy charged particles and X-rays. These detectors are mounted on a PC board with an opening for the purpose of ΔE/E detection of charged particles and X-rays.
